How to Convert Minute to Hour

1 minute = 0.0166667 hours exact

Hour = Minute × 0.0166667

Example: 66 min × 0.0166667 = 1.1 h

Reverse Conversion

To convert hours back to minutes:

  • Remember, 1 hour equals 60 minutes.
  • To convert 1.1 h to min, multiply 1.1 x 60, resulting in 66 min.

exact This conversion factor is exact by international definition.

About these units

Minute: min — The minute is a unit of time equal to exactly 60 seconds. It is not an SI unit but is accepted for use with the SI system.

Hour: h — The hour is a unit of time equal to exactly 3,600 seconds or 60 minutes. It is not an SI unit but is accepted for use with the SI system.
